Nestled between New York Avenue and Gallaudet University, Union Market offers a great location in east DC. Perfect for commuters, students, and faculty, Union Market offers several modern apartment complexes for rent with distant views of the city. A food market of the same name, Union Market brings in people from all over the city with its array of artisans offering local eats like charcuterie, empanadas, gelato, and so much more. The Metro runs directly through Union Market, so residents can easily get into the heart of DC and beyond in just minutes.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
